Justice Kayani claims state institutions collapsed; NA Speaker rejects remarks
Share on WhatAppShare on XShare on Facebook

Islamabad, February 11, 2025: Islamabad High Court’s Justice Mohsin Akhtar Kayani expressed deep concerns over the state of governance in Pakistan, stating that living in the country feels like a constant battle.

During a court proceeding on Tuesday, Justice Kayani remarked, “The judiciary is also a pillar of the state, yet the pillars of the state seem to be floating in the air. However, I am not hopeless.” He further observed that the judiciary, parliament, and executive institutions have all collapsed.

Justice Kayani also highlighted the role of the younger generation, asserting, “Anyone above 45 years old, including myself, is useless. It is the youth who have to do something for this country.”

His remarks, however, drew strong criticism from National Assembly Speaker Ayaz Sadiq, who termed them “unacceptable.” Addressing the assembly, Speaker Sadiq said, “Today, a media report surfaced in which a judge stated that the executive, judiciary, and parliament have collapsed. No one has the right to make statements against parliament, as it is our privilege.” He urged the law minister to deliver a firm message to the judge, emphasizing that such remarks would not be tolerated.
